Abstract
PROCEDIMIENTO E INSTALACION PARA PROTEGER LAS CANALIZACIONES DE AGUA CONTRA LA CORROSION; EN ESTE PROCEDIMIENTO SE AÑADE AL AGUA TRANSPORTADA LA CANTIDAD DE CAL APROPIADA PARA CONFERIRLE PROPIEDADES INCRUSTANTES. ANTES DE SER INTRODUCIDA EN EL SATURADOR (S), EL AGUA TOMADA DE LA CANALIZACION SE MEZCLA EN UN DESCARBONATADOR (D) CON UNA SOLUCION DESPROVISTA DE CO2 TOTAL Y CARGADA DE CAL PROVENIENTE DEL SATURADOR (S), A FIN DE PERMITIR LA ELIMINACION CASI COMPLETA DEL CO2 TOTAL EN EL DESCARBONATADOR (D) POR PRECIPITACION DE CACO3. UTILIZACION ESPECIAL PARA PROTEGER CONTRA LA CORROSION LAS PAREDES INTERIORES DE METALES FERREOS O A BASE DE CEMENTO DE LAS CANALIZACIONES DE AGUA.
